Start your day by exploring the capital city of Maldives, Malé. With its colorful buildings, bustling markets, and serene mosques, Malé offers a glimpse into the local Maldivian culture. Visit the historic Hukuru Miskiy mosque, stroll through the bustling fish market, and indulge in some local street food.

Indulge in a delicious seafood lunch at one of the seaside restaurants on Maafushi Island. Feast on fresh catches of the day, grilled prawns, and flavorful curries while enjoying the stunning ocean views. Don't forget to try some traditional Maldivian dishes like Garudhiya (fish soup) and Mashuni (tuna salad).

Head to Hulhumalé Island, located near the airport, to visit the Maldives Victory, a popular dive site and an underwater museum. Explore the wreckage of this cargo ship that sank in 1981, now covered in vibrant corals and inhabited by a variety of marine life. Snorkel or dive among the colorful fish and witness the beauty of the underwater world.

While exploring Maldives, make sure to visit the local islands and interact with the friendly Maldivian people. Take a ferry to a nearby local island to experience the authentic Maldivian way of life and explore the local markets, mosques, and cafes. Don't miss the chance to try traditional Maldivian delicacies like Rihaakuru (fish paste) and Huni Roshi (coconut flatbread). These off the beaten path attractions and interactions with locals will give you a deeper understanding of the rich cultural heritage of the Maldives.
